WebbIf your Vacuum Cleaner keeps shutting off when you’re vacuuming, then it’s most likely 2 things. Either your motor is overheating, or you have an electrical issue. The biggest and most common reason why a vacuum cleaner keeps shutting off is due to overheating – which can be easy to solve. The electrical issue can be more involved and may ... Webb26 mars 2024 · If you notice your Shark spinning around, the navigation algorithm may be the issue. The robot vacuum is probably trying to cover more area by spinning in open spaces. You can solve this by; turning off your Shark, dusting off the bumper lens with a clean and dry cloth, then pressing the bumper multiple times to confirm it can move freely.
